Mary Taber 1790–1850 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1790

Birth Location: Providence, Providence, Rhode Island, USA

Death Date: 7 July 1850

Death Location: Tiverton, Newport, Rhode Island, United States

Father: Gideon Taber

Mother: Sarah Hicks

Spouse(s): Lewis HART

Children(s): Joseph Hart

The story of Mary Taber began in 1790 in Providence, Providence, Rhode Island, USA. Mary Taber married Lewis Hart, and had children including Joseph Hart. Mary Taber passed away in 1850 in Tiverton, Newport, Rhode Island, United States.
